Chicken Divan(Great For Lots Of People)
Chicken Divan is a creamy, cheesy casserole featuring tender chicken, broccoli, and a rich sherry-infused sauce, perfect for feeding a crowd or family dinner.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Melt butter in a saucepan.
- Add flour and stir until bubbly.
- Gradually add chicken broth, stirring constantly until the sauce thickens.
- Stir in cooking sherry and nutmeg.
- Fold in whipped heavy cream.
- Add grated Parmesan cheese and stir for 2 minutes until melted.
Tips & Substitutions
For best results, use freshly cooked chicken breasts for a moist texture. If you're looking to lighten the dish, consider substituting half of the heavy cream with Greek yogurt. You can also swap broccoli with asparagus or green beans if desired. For added flavor, try incorporating garlic or shallots when melting the butter.
Serving Suggestions
Serve Chicken Divan over a bed of rice or alongside a fresh salad for a complete meal. It pairs beautifully with Mom's Oven-Barbecued Chicken for a delightful spread. Consider adding a side of garlic bread or roasted vegetables for added flavor and texture.
Storage &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place in a preheated oven at 350°F until warmed through, about 20-25 minutes. You can also reheat in the microwave, but be sure to cover it to retain moisture.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en broccoli instead of fresh?
Yes, you can use frozen broccoli, but make sure to thaw and drain it well to avoid excess moisture in the dish. This will help maintain the right consistency of the sauce.
How can I make this dish gluten-free?
To make Chicken Divan gluten-free, subst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end or cornstarch for thickening the sauce. Ensure that the chicken broth and any added ingredients are also gluten-free.
Can I prepare this dish 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the sauce and assemble the dish a day in advance. Just cover it tightly and refrigerate. When ready to serve, bake it straight from the fridge, adding a few extra minutes to the cooking time.
